Frequently Asked Questions about Margate
How much are Studio apartments in Margate?
There are currently 82 Studio Apartments in Margate with rent ranges from $1,340 to $2,454 with an average price of $1,897.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Margate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Margate ranges from $1,325 to $5,846 with an average monthly rent of $2,022.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Margate c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Margate range from $1,650 to $4,602.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,438.
How expensive are Margate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 118 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Margate on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$2,090 to $4,158 - averaging $2,903 for the location.
